探索Web视频抓取利器:scrapy_for_video
去发现同类优质开源项目:https://gitcode.com/
在这个多媒体盛行的时代,数据抓取特别是视频信息的提取变得日益重要。如果你正在寻找一个高效且易用的工具来帮助你抓取网页上的视频资源,那么项目可能是你的理想选择。
项目简介
scrapy_for_video
是基于强大的Scrapy框架构建的一个插件,专门用于从网页中发现和下载视频文件。它结合了Scrapy的灵活性和对网络爬虫的强大支持,为视频数据挖掘提供了便利的解决方案。
技术分析
-
Scrapy集成:
scrapy_for_video
充分利用了Scrapy的爬虫结构,可以在Scrapy现有的项目中轻松集成,无需复杂的配置或额外的学习成本。 -
智能视频检测: 该项目采用了高效的正则表达式和HTML解析策略,能够准确地识别出网页中的视频URL,无论是嵌入在HTML中的直接链接还是通过JavaScript动态加载的。
-
多平台适应性: 它支持从各种流行的视频分享网站(如YouTube、Vimeo等)抓取视频,并且可以应对不同的视频编码和技术实现。
-
灵活的下载选项: 用户可以选择仅下载视频,也可以选择连同元数据一起抓取,比如标题、描述和标签,便于后期的数据处理和分析。
-
可扩展性和定制化: 由于是基于Scrapy构建,你可以根据需要编写自定义中间件和爬虫,以适应特定的需求或复杂的情况。
应用场景
- 数据分析与研究:收集大量视频数据进行内容分析,例如流行趋势、情感分析等。
- 教育与学习:批量获取在线课程,搭建个性化学习平台。
- 媒体监控:跟踪特定主题的视频发布,及时获取最新资讯。
- 娱乐与生活:自动化下载个人喜好的视频内容,离线观看。
特点
- 易于使用:简单的API接口使得在现有Scrapy项目中添加视频抓取功能变得简单。
- 高效稳定:基于成熟的Scrapy框架,保证了数据抓取的效率和可靠性。
- 开源免费:遵循MIT许可证,你可以自由地使用、修改和分享这个项目。
如果你想进一步探索Web视频抓取的世界,或者正在寻找一个功能强大而又易于上手的工具,那么scrapy_for_video
无疑是一个值得尝试的选择。现在就加入社区,开始你的视频数据之旅吧!
去发现同类优质开源项目:https://gitcode.com/